titleOfInvention Flavor dot odorizer and method
abstract A method, and apparatus is taught to help infants change diets. An absorbent pad (12) having an odorant is placed on a baby bottle so as to be near the baby's nose when ingesting. First the odorant is paired to a flavored diet of the baby. Then the odorant is coupled to a novel diet which the baby is not so fond of. The result is that the baby ingests more than usual of the novel diet. Other aspects include a flavor ring (1500) on a baby bottle (4) or a bowl (172) and a plurality of flavor dots (160) on a baby bottle (4) or bowl (172). The inventive concept of placing a pleasing odorant near a user's nose during drinking can help babies, elderly people, and even pets ingest more fluids.
